The study aims to analyze the effectiveness of Telegram and WhatsApp in teaching English as a second language based on the insights gathered from the interviews and data obtained from various sources. The method used in this study is the qualitative descriptive method. The qualitative descriptive method allows for a detailed exploration of the participants’ experiences and perceptions, which is crucial in understanding their preferences and attitudes toward these communication platforms. The data used in this study was obtained through interviews with 2 English lecturers and 20 students who learned English through Telegram and WhatsApp. Data is also taken from books, journals, and the internet. Both of these applications can be an effective alternative to learning English compared to Zoom, especially in the current post-pandemic that limits face-to-face teaching and learning activities. The advantages and disadvantages of each application must be considered and matched to the needs and preferences of each individual before deciding to use a particular application as an English learning medium.
